What does the abbreviation LLP stand for in the context of contact lenses?

Explanation:
In the context of contact lenses, the abbreviation LLP stands for Lacrimal Lens Power. This term refers to the power of the tear film layer, or lacrimal lens, that forms between the contact lens and the cornea. This layer plays a crucial role in the overall optical performance of the contact lens, as it affects how light is refracted as it passes through the lens and into the eye. Understanding the concept of Lacrimal Lens Power is important for eye care professionals when fitting contact lenses and ensuring optimal vision correction. The effectiveness of the contact lens depends not only on its inherent power but also on the interaction with the tear film, which can influence comfort and clarity of vision for the wearer.
